Japanese baking has gained international acclaim primarily due to the unique texture of its breads, characterized by a soft, moist, and "mochi-mochi" (chewy) crumb. This distinct quality is rarely an accident of technique alone; it is heavily dictated by the specific characteristics of bread flour in Japan. Unlike the standardized bread flours found in many Western markets, the Japanese market offers a highly segmented range of flours tailored to specific types of loaves, ranging from the pillowy Shokupan to the crisp, airy baguette.

Understanding the Kyoryukiko Classification

In Japan, wheat flour is categorized by its protein content, with "Kyoryukiko" (strong flour) being the standard designation for bread flour. Most professional-grade bread flour in Japan features a protein content ranging from 11.5% to 13.5%. However, protein is only one part of the equation. The milling process in Japan is exceptionally refined, often resulting in a finer particle size than European or American flours. This fine granulation enhances water absorption and allows for a more delicate gluten structure.

Beyond standard strong flour, bakers often encounter "Jun-kyoryukiko" (semi-strong flour). This category usually sits between 11.0% and 12.0% protein and is the preferred choice for French-style breads, rustic boules, and croissants. The lower protein content, combined with specific ash levels, facilitates a thinner, crispier crust and a more open crumb structure, which is a hallmark of artisan baking in Japan.

Technical Indicators: Protein and Ash Content

When evaluating bread flour in Japan, professional bakers look at two primary numbers: protein percentage and ash content.

The Role of Protein

Protein determines the strength of the gluten network. A high-protein flour like the "Super King" from Nisshin Seifun (approximately 13.8%) provides immense lift and volume, making it ideal for bread machines or loaves with heavy inclusions like nuts and dried fruits. Conversely, a flour like "Eagle" by Nippn (12.0%) offers a more balanced elasticity and extensibility, suitable for daily table rolls and standard sandwich breads.

The Significance of Ash Content

Ash content refers to the minerals remaining after the flour is burned. In the Japanese milling tradition, a lower ash content (around 0.33% to 0.45%) usually indicates a more refined flour taken from the center of the wheat endosperm. This results in a bright white crumb and a clean, mild flavor. Higher ash content (0.45% to 0.60%) brings more of the wheat's natural aroma and a creamier color to the bread. For instance, flours used for hard-crust breads, such as the "Napoleon" brand, often feature slightly higher ash levels to provide that characteristic deep, nutty fragrance.

Iconic Brands and Their Professional Specs

The Japanese milling industry is dominated by several major players, each offering legendary brands that have become staples in both commercial and home kitchens.

Nippn (Nippon Flour Mills)

Nippn produces some of the most consistent flours available.

  • Eagle: Often considered the benchmark for bread flour in Japan. It is reliable, with a protein content of around 12.0%, providing a good balance for almost any yeasted dough.
  • Queen: This is a premium bread flour with a slightly higher protein content (12.3%). It is favored for its fermentation stability, allowing for a high-volume loaf with an exceptionally fine texture.
  • Casarine: Specifically marketed for premium toast bread. It uses only the best parts of the wheat kernel to ensure maximum moisture retention, creating a loaf that stays soft for days.

Nisshin Seifun

Nisshin is known for its technical precision and specialized blends.

  • Super King: The go-to for many who want a dramatic rise. Its high protein and specific milling process make it very forgiving for beginners using bread machines.
  • Golden Yacht: A "strongest" flour blend that often includes malt or other conditioners to produce a very tall, light, and airy loaf. It is frequently blended with weaker flours to "boost" their performance.
  • Risd'or: The industry standard for French bread in Japan. It is a semi-strong flour that allows for the perfect balance of extensibility and strength required for shaping long baguettes.

The Hokkaido Wheat Revolution

In recent years, there has been a significant shift toward domestic wheat, specifically from Hokkaido. While Japan historically imported most of its bread wheat from North America, Hokkaido's agricultural advancements have produced varieties that rival or even surpass imported grain in quality.

Haruyokoi and Haruyutaka

These are perhaps the most famous domestic varieties. Haruyokoi is celebrated for its natural sweetness and its ability to produce an incredibly soft, chewy texture. Because pure Haruyokoi can be difficult to handle due to its high gluten strength, it is often sold as a "blend" to improve workability for home bakers. Breads made with these flours are characterized by a distinct "wheaty" aroma that is more pronounced than in commodity flours.

Yume Chikara

This is an "ultra-strong" variety with protein levels that can exceed 14%. It is rarely used on its own for bread; instead, it serves as a powerful blending agent. When mixed with lower-protein domestic wheats (like Kitahonami), it creates a flour that has the strength of North American wheat but the unique flavor profile of Japanese soil.

Special Purpose Flours: Beyond the Loaf

The versatility of bread flour in Japan extends into specialized culinary applications. For example, specific flours are milled for "Mochi Bread" (using a mix of wheat and glutinous rice properties) to achieve a hyper-chewy texture. Others, like the "Take" brand, are optimized for noodle-making, where the gluten needs to be strong but the texture must remain silky and smooth.

For those venturing into enriched doughs like Danish pastries or croissants, flours like "Napoleon" provide the necessary structural integrity to hold layers of butter without becoming overly tough. The ability to choose a flour based on its specific extensibility (the ability to stretch) versus its elasticity (the ability to snap back) is what allows Japanese bakers to achieve such diverse textures.

Practical Tips for Working with Japanese Flour

When using bread flour in Japan, one must adjust their hydration expectations. Due to the fine milling and high quality of the gluten, these flours can often absorb significantly more water than standard all-purpose flours.

  1. High Hydration: For a standard Shokupan, many Japanese recipes call for 70% to 80% hydration. Premium flours like Casarine or Hokkaido-grown Haruyokoi are particularly adept at holding this moisture, which translates to a longer shelf life and a more tender crumb.
  2. The Yudane Method: To maximize the potential of high-quality Japanese flour, many use the "Yudane" method—mixing a portion of the flour with boiling water to gelatinize the starches. This technique, combined with the natural sweetness of Japanese wheat, produces the ultimate soft bread.
  3. Temperature Sensitivity: Because of the fine grind, these flours can be sensitive to friction heat during mechanical kneading. Bakers often use chilled water to ensure the dough temperature remains optimal (around 26°C-28°C) for gluten development.

Sourcing and Storage in 2026

As of 2026, sourcing these professional-grade flours has become increasingly accessible. While supermarkets carry standard Eagle or Nisshin flours, serious enthusiasts typically turn to specialty providers like Tomizawa Shoten (Tomiz) or Ebetsu Flour Milling for site-specific Hokkaido varieties.

Packaging in Japan is often designed for freshness, with many 1kg and 2.5kg bags featuring high-quality seals. However, given the high protein and lipid content in premium domestic flours, they are more prone to oxidation. Storing flour in a cool, dark, and dry environment is essential. Many professional bakers in Japan recommend using domestic Hokkaido flours within three to six months of the milling date to ensure the aromatics are at their peak.
